  • Unusual Encrypting File System Remote call (EFSRPC) to domain controller Low Identity Analytics 3 variations

    An unusual Encrypting File System Remote call (EFSRPC) was made to a domain controller.

    Activation:
    14 Days
    Training:
    30 Days
    Test:
    N/A (single event)
    Deduplication:
    1 Day
    ATT&CK tactics: Credential Access (TA0006)
    ATT&CK techniques: Forced Authentication (T1187) Adversary-in-the-Middle: Name Resolution Poisoning and SMB Relay (T1557.001)
    Required data: XDR Agent with eXtended Threat Hunting (XTH)
    Attacker's goals: An attacker can abuse the Encrypting File System Remote Protocol to coerce authentication from a DC. This authentication can later be used for obtaining a DC certificate for DCSync.
    Investigative actions: Check for a suspicious process on the initiator. Check if the source host is a vulnerability scanner. Check for unusual connections from the server of the requested file location (it may be a relay server). Look for unusual AD CS certificate requests. Look for following suspicious connections using the DC machine account. Check for possible DCSync alerts.
